VA Man Charged with DWI After Cayuga County Crash Detected By iPhone Alert

The Cayuga County Sheriff’s Office says a Virginia man was arrested early Saturday morning after deputies responded to an iPhone crash detection alert in the Town of Fleming.

Deputies were called to the area of West Lake Road and Buck Point Road around 3:04 a.m., where they found a heavily damaged vehicle that had struck a culvert. The driver, 22-year-old Isaias Presas-Reyes of North Chesterfield, Virginia, was being evaluated by EMS but refused transport to the hospital.

According to the sheriff’s office, Presas-Reyes showed signs of intoxication and later failed field sobriety tests. He was taken into custody and brought to the Public Safety Building, where a chemical breath test registered a blood-alcohol content of 0.17 percent.

Presas-Reyes was charged with DWI first offense, DWI with a BAC of 0.08 percent or higher, moving from a lane unsafely, and operating a vehicle without a license.

He was released on traffic tickets and is scheduled to appear in Fleming Town Court on Tuesday at 4:30 p.m.

The fact that a defendant has been charged with a crime is merely an accusation, and the defendant is presumed innocent until and unless proven guilty.
